Hi all I know this is a rainbow boa forum, but I thought this might be the best place to ask! (im a member of The cornsnake forum) Im collecting a Hogg island boa at the end of the month and im doing a bit of research 1st, so if any 1 can answer the following questions for me it would be appreciated - what are the perfect temps for a hogg island? Does there need to be a certain level of humidity? and is a hydrogometer needed? its a cb10 so what would the best substrate be? Thanks in advance  |

I have a Hogg Island Boa & would say temps of upto 30-31'C (basking temp) should be fine. As for substrate you can use anything from newspaper (i prefer unprinted), aspen, beech chips, orchid bark (kept dry) etc. I personally use a product called megazorb which i find works very well, just make sure that a plate or similar is put down for feeding to stop ingestion of the substrate  Average room humidity should be fine (40-50%), i don't use a Hygrometer for mine, be sure to post pics once you get your new addition  |
